www.citypages.pro - City Pages Pro
Showing 1 - 1 of 1 Results

Local Businesses Offering Web Site Hosting in Vadodara

Vadodara's Top Rated Web Site Hosting Local Businesses


Scrupulous Technology

D, W, Web Design, Web Site Developers, Web Site Hosting, Digital Marketing Agency
Vadodara, Gujarat, India
9510854321